What are the 200 mesh limestone powder making equipment available?

200 mesh limestone powder making equipment typically involves a combination of crushing, grinding, and classifying processes to achieve the desired particle size and product quality. Here are some of the commonly used equipment for limestone powder production with a 200-mesh particle size:

1. Jaw crusher: Jaw crushers are primary crushing equipment used to reduce large limestone chunks into smaller particles. They are often the first step in the powder production process.

2. Impact crusher:Impact crushers are suitable for secondary crushing tasks, converting limestone chunks into finer particles. They can handle varying degrees of hardness and are efficient in processing limestone with a high degree of abrasiveness.

3. Cone crusher: Cone crushers are used for fine crushing and can produce limestone powder with a 200-mesh particle size. They are suitable for processing hard and abrasive limestone materials.

4. Vertical shaft impact (VSI) crusher: VSI crushers are known for their high efficiency in producing fine particles. They can achieve a 200-mesh particle size with minimal power consumption and low wear and tear on the equipment.

5. Hammer mill: Hammer mills are grinding machines that use rotating hammers to shred limestone chunks into smaller particles. They are suitable for producing limestone powder with a 200-mesh size range.

6. Roll mill: Roll mills are used for fine grinding limestone and can achieve a 200-mesh particle size. They offer high efficiency, low energy consumption, and minimal maintenance requirements.

7. Ball mill: Ball mills are traditional grinding equipment used in the cement and mining industries. They are designed to grind limestone into fine powder by means of friction between steel balls and the mill's inner surface.

8. Stirred mill: Stirred mills, also known as horizontal stirred media mills, are energy-efficient grinding equipment suitable for producing fine limestone powder. They operate in a closed-loop system, ensuring minimal particle loss and low environmental impact.

9. Attrition mill: Attrition mills use grinding media, such as steel shots or beads, to grind limestone particles against each other, resulting in a fine powder with a 200-mesh size.

10. Classifier: After crushing and grinding limestone particles, classifiers are used to separate and collect particles of a specific size range. They ensure a uniform particle size distribution and help maintain the desired 200-mesh particle size.

11. Dust collector: Dust collectors are essential equipment for capturing and filtering dust generated during the powder production process. They help maintain a clean working environment and protect the surrounding area from airborne particles.

It's important to note that the choice of equipment depends on factors such as feed size, desired output particle size, production capacity, and budget.
